Arakan Army fully captures Myanmar junta’s western HQ in Rakhine State

The AA confirms that it has captured the regime’s Western Regional Military Command in Ann Township, liberating the majority of the state from junta forces

The Arakan Army (AA) took full control of the Myanmar junta’s Western Regional Military Command (RMC) headquarters in Rakhine State’s Ann Township on Friday, according to a spokesperson for the group.

“Today, December 20, at around 12pm, the AA took full control of the Western Military Regional Command headquarters,” the AA’s spokesperson, Khaing Thukha, confirmed to Myanmar Now.
